1️⃣ CSV User Importer for Jira

Onboard users in bulk — fast, error-free, and without writing a single line of code. Upload a CSV, map your fields, and you’re done. Perfect for new projects, mergers, or scaling up teams.

2️⃣ Bulk User Delete for Jira

Clean up your Jira instance by removing inactive or redundant users with just a few clicks. Import via CSV or select users individually — get real-time deletion status updates and maintain a tidy, secure environment.

3️⃣ Enhanced User Profile for Jira

Go beyond the default Jira user data. View enriched profiles that include roles, activity logs, issue involvement, and more—all in one place. This is great for user audits and team transparency.

4️⃣ User Suspension

Automatically suspend inactive or risky users across all your Atlassian tools. Set schedules, manage jobs, and optimize your license usage while improving security posture.
